Umbilical Repair

As most of you know, Kamryn was born with an umbilical hernia, which basically means that her belly button didn't close on the inside, causing her intestines and fluid to protrude out through her belly button. I made a post about it last year and you can see a picture of the "belly nubbin" here. Anyway, we took her to Primary Children's a few weeks ago to have a consultation with a surgeon and he told us we should get it fixed unless we want to wait until right before she goes to Kindergarten. (If we don't get it fixed at all, it could cause problems later in life when she wants to have children.) We decided to get it over with and she won't remember it at this age. So, tomorrow is the big day. We have to be there at 6am and surgery is scheduled for 7:30am. It will probably only be a 15 minute procedure and we should be home by mid-morning if all goes well. The doctor said he does this procedure 1-2 times a week so it's pretty common. We are still nervous of course, but it's a minor thing and we are greatful that it's not something more serious.
